Reus looks increasingly likely to leave the Signal Iduna Park at the end of this season and possibly before the end of the month, with a number of European clubs interested.

The Bundesliga star recently turned down a new contract offered to him by Dortmund and will be looking for a move within the coming year.

Arsenal are believd to be in the lead to sign the winger and now Spanish newspaper Vozpopuli claims Reus held talks with Arsene Wenger earlier this summer over a potential move.

The paper goes on to say that talks went well but the Gunners postponed any bids due to the injury the Dortmund man was suffering heavily from, but they are now ready to begin the pursuit once more.

It won’t be easy for Wenger’s side to sign the German international due to the competition they face from German champions Bayern Munich, as well as Manchester United and Atletico Madrid.
